Software design includes low-level component and algorithm implementation issues as well as the architectural view. The software requirements analysis (SRA) step of a software development process yields specifications that are used in software engineering. A software design may be platform-independent or platform-specific, depending on the availability of the technology called for by the design. Design is a meaningful engineering representation of something that is to be built. It can be traced to a customer's requirements and at the same time assessed for quality against a set of predefined criteria for "good" design. In the software engineering context, design focuses on four major areas of concern, data, architecture, interfaces, and components.
The Franklin Ohio Agreement to Design and Construct Software is a comprehensive legal document that outlines the terms and conditions for the development and implementation of software in Franklin, Ohio. This agreement serves as a legally binding contract between the software developer and the client, ensuring the successful delivery of a well-designed and functional software application. Keywords: Franklin Ohio, agreement, design, construct, software There are three main types of Franklin Ohio Agreement to Design and Construct Software: 1. Standard Franklin Ohio Agreement to Design and Construct Software: This type of agreement establishes the general terms and conditions for the software development project. It covers essential aspects such as project scope, deliverables, timelines, intellectual property rights, payment terms, and support services. The agreement serves as a solid foundation for the project, ensuring both parties are aligned and committed to meeting the project objectives. 2. Custom Franklin Ohio Agreement to Design and Construct Software: A custom agreement is tailored to meet the specific needs and requirements of a particular software development project. It takes into account unique aspects of the project, including specialized functionalities, integration with existing systems, and additional services such as training or maintenance. This type of agreement allows for flexibility and addresses individual project complexities, while still adhering to the general principles covered in the standard agreement. 3. Franklin Ohio Agreement to Design and Construct Software with Intellectual Property Considerations: This agreement variant places significant emphasis on intellectual property rights and ownership. It defines the ownership of the software, including copyrights, trademarks, patents, and trade secrets. It ensures that the client retains full proprietary rights over the software, while granting the developer appropriate licenses to use and modify the software for the project's purposes. This type of agreement is particularly important when dealing with sensitive or proprietary information. Regardless of the specific type, all Franklin Ohio Agreements to Design and Construct Software are designed to protect the interests of both the software developer and the client. They establish clear guidelines and responsibilities, and help mitigate potential conflicts during the software development process in Franklin, Ohio.
The Franklin Ohio Agreement to Design and Construct Software is a comprehensive legal document that outlines the terms and conditions for the development and implementation of software in Franklin, Ohio. This agreement serves as a legally binding contract between the software developer and the client, ensuring the successful delivery of a well-designed and functional software application. Keywords: Franklin Ohio, agreement, design, construct, software There are three main types of Franklin Ohio Agreement to Design and Construct Software: 1. Standard Franklin Ohio Agreement to Design and Construct Software: This type of agreement establishes the general terms and conditions for the software development project. It covers essential aspects such as project scope, deliverables, timelines, intellectual property rights, payment terms, and support services. The agreement serves as a solid foundation for the project, ensuring both parties are aligned and committed to meeting the project objectives. 2. Custom Franklin Ohio Agreement to Design and Construct Software: A custom agreement is tailored to meet the specific needs and requirements of a particular software development project. It takes into account unique aspects of the project, including specialized functionalities, integration with existing systems, and additional services such as training or maintenance. This type of agreement allows for flexibility and addresses individual project complexities, while still adhering to the general principles covered in the standard agreement. 3. Franklin Ohio Agreement to Design and Construct Software with Intellectual Property Considerations: This agreement variant places significant emphasis on intellectual property rights and ownership. It defines the ownership of the software, including copyrights, trademarks, patents, and trade secrets. It ensures that the client retains full proprietary rights over the software, while granting the developer appropriate licenses to use and modify the software for the project's purposes. This type of agreement is particularly important when dealing with sensitive or proprietary information. Regardless of the specific type, all Franklin Ohio Agreements to Design and Construct Software are designed to protect the interests of both the software developer and the client. They establish clear guidelines and responsibilities, and help mitigate potential conflicts during the software development process in Franklin, Ohio.